Raspberry & Oat Breakfast Bars

Makes 16 bars

Ingredients

Dry:
  • 300g rolled oats
  • 75g coconut sugar
  • 1 tsp. baking powder
  • 1 tsp. cinnamon
  • 30g chopped almonds
Wet:
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 banana (mashed)
  • 1 tsp. vanilla extract
  • 125ml milk
To decorate:
  • Handful chopped almonds
  • 1 tbsp. chia seeds
  • 50g raspberries (chopped)

Method

  1. Preheat oven to 175°C/ 350°F.
  2. Add all dry ingredients to a large bowl and mix together until fully combined.
  3. In another bowl, mix together all the wet ingredients until fully combined, then add wet mixture to dry mixture and stir thoroughly.
  4. Transfer to a lined 8x8” baking tray and flatten using a spatula.
  5. Decorate the top with chopped almonds, chia seeds, and raspberries, then bake for 30 minutes.
  6. Once baked, remove and leave to cool before slicing into 16 bars.

calories129
totalFat4
totalCarbohydrates17
protein4
